Cobra 75 problem?
I installed my Cobra75 and went to tune the swr. I would key the mic and the airbag warning light would come on. I let off and it goes out. Sometimes it will set the abs warning lights as well. I thought I would recheck the ground on the battery. When I unhooked the ground wire the radio stayed on. It did turn off when I unplugged the antenna wire. Is there a short in the radio or any other ideas?

Battery is 2 weeks old. I did another experiment today. I left the antenna connected and hooked the power leads up to a 13 volt plug in transformer. Keyed the mic and the airbag light came on. A short in the radio to the antenna connection maybe?
Running a fire flex coax with a fire ring to an expedition one mount, a quick connector and a 4 foot fire stick. Cable is running down the passenger side, under the door sill to under the glove box.

Fixed! (I think). I took the door sill pannel off and re routed the coax under the carpet further away from the wiring in the same area. No more airbag or check engine lights. Rechecking swr in the morning.
That's what I did to fix my original install. No airbag light, but the wipers would cycle with every mic key.
The coax Firestik uses is not the best quality and tends to be a little "leaky". The JK's electronics are very sensitive to stray RF.
